Sportswashing, Meaning and Global Application

Sportswashing is a public relations strategy where a government, corporation, or regime uses high-profile sporting events, team ownerships, or athlete sponsorships to polish its tarnished reputation. The goal is to divert international attention away from poor human rights records, political corruption, or controversial military actions.
